  9. Dodutils

    Where do you get high quality lens replacement?

    personaly I buy mine from banggood, especially the 12 and 16mm, they also provide M12 lens extender because for 12 and 16mm or higher you may have to "unscrew" to the max and it could be too short depending the M12 mount you have. But take care about the 25/35/50mm I am not confident in...

  16. Dodutils

    Raspberry Pi as an IP Camera for BI

    You must make RasPi act like a MJPEG or RTSP IP camera you have many ways to do it. Best one is to turn it into RTSP camera as the RaspiCam is already H.264 so no video convertion needed, nearly no CPU usage. You can try this way Raspberry PI (Ver 2.0) + PI Cam as a stable RTSP Server -...
